Logistical Management by Organizers
Organizers of free turkey giveaways must carefully manage logistics, including transportation, food preparation, and distribution. Here are three ways they manage these aspects:
- Transportation: Organizers must arrange transportation for the turkeys and other items from the distribution location to the recipient’s address. This may involve renting a truck or van or enlisting volunteers’ help. A well-planned transportation strategy is essential to ensure that the items are delivered on time and efficiently.
- Food Preparation: Depending on the scale of the event, organizers may need to prepare and package the turkeys themselves, which can include cooking, packaging, and labeling. They may enlist the help of local chefs or volunteers to assist with food preparation.
- Distribution: Organizers must also manage the distribution process, ensuring that recipients receive the correct items and that the process runs smoothly. This may involve setting up a system for recipients to pick up their turkeys, or delivering them directly to households.
Organizers of free turkey giveaways face numerous challenges in managing logistics, including transportation, food preparation, and distribution. These challenges include ensuring timely delivery, coordinating volunteer help, and managing the budget and resources effectively. By developing a solid plan and working closely with partners, organizers are able to overcome these challenges and provide a successful and impactful free turkey giveaway.
Health and Nutrition Benefits of Free Turkey Giveaways
Free turkey giveaways are a significant event in many local communities, providing an essential source of food for many individuals, especially in low-income households. The nutritional value of turkey and its implications on a balanced diet are essential aspects to consider.
Turkey is an excellent source of lean protein, rich in nutrients such as niacin, vitamin B6, and selenium. A 3-ounce serving of cooked turkey contains approximately 26 grams of protein, making it an ideal addition to a balanced diet. According to the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A), turkey is also low in saturated fat and cholesterol, making it a heart-healthy option.
Comparing the nutritional value of turkey to other poultry options, such as chicken and duck, it is evident that turkey stands out for its high protein content and lower fat levels. For instance, a 3-ounce serving of cooked chicken contains about 24 grams of protein, whereas a 3-ounce serving of duck contains approximately 23 grams of protein.
Nutritional Benefits of Turkey
- Turkey is an excellent source of lean protein, essential for muscle growth and maintenance.
- Turkey is rich in niacin, a B vitamin that helps maintain healthy skin and mucous membranes.
- Turkey is a good source of selenium, an antioxidant that protects cells from damage and supports immune function.
- Turkey contains a significant amount of vitamin B6, which is essential for brain function and the formation of red blood cells.
